Atlanta at a Glance
Adair Park sits just south of downtown Atlanta, bordered by the railroad tracks that once marked the city's industrial edge. The neighborhood dates to the early 1900s and carries that history in its architecture, with original bungalows, Victorian-era homes, and newer construction woven throughout. Housing options range from single-family homes to duplexes and small apartment communities, giving renters an accessible path into intown Atlanta living without the higher price tags found in more centrally located neighborhoods.
One-bedroom apartments average around $1,600 per month, while two-bedroom units typically land in the mid-$1,900s, making Adair Park one of the more affordable options for renters who want proximity to downtown employment centers and the broader metro area.
The neighborhood has been undergoing steady revitalization, with longtime residents and newer arrivals alike invested in preserving its architectural character while supporting thoughtful improvements. The streets are tree-lined and relatively quiet compared to busier intown districts, and neighbors tend to know each other. For renters who prioritize both value and location, Adair Park offers a grounded, community-oriented alternative to pricier parts of the city.
